The Role of Luck
Luck plays a significant role in SixSixSix because it influences the outcome of each roll. Each time you throw the dice, there’s an element of chance that affects your score. For instance, rolling a pair of ones is highly dependent on luck; you can’t predict with certainty whether this will happen.
However, even within the realm of luck, certain patterns and probabilities exist. For example, the probability of rolling any specific number (like a one) on each die is 1/6. The probability of rolling two identical numbers in a single roll is therefore 6/36 or 1/6. This fundamental concept underscores why getting pairs can be both exhilarating and frustrating—success is not guaranteed, but understanding the odds can help players manage their expectations.
Strategic Skill and Decision Making
While luck cannot be controlled, skill in SixSixSix comes into play through strategic decision-making and effective gameplay. Players must make decisions based on probabilities, past rolls, and future outcomes. For instance:
- Optimizing Rolls : Experienced players learn when to hold onto a pair of dice or roll again for a potentially higher score.
- Managing Risk vs. Reward : Deciding whether to risk another roll in pursuit of a higher score or to secure the current points can be a critical skill.
- Adaptive Play : Adjusting your strategy based on the game state (e.g., if you need one more pair to win) is essential for skilled play.
